No person or operating unit in the state other than the retail purchasers from the authority permitted by § 30-122, shall become a purchaser of electrical energy generated by the waters of the main stream of the Colorado river, unless it first obtains a power purchase certificate issued by the authority as provided by this chapter.
Cite this article: FindLaw.com - Arizona Revised Statutes Title 30. Power § 30-151. Certificate prerequisite to purchase of power - last updated January 01, 2025 | https://codes.findlaw.com/az/title-30-power/az-rev-st-sect-30-151/
